Understanding Uterine Fibroids
Fibroids, also known as uterine leiomyomas, are benign tumors that develop from the muscle tissue of the uterus. They vary in size and number and can be located in different parts of the uterus. While some women with fibroids experience no symptoms, others may face:
– Heavy or prolonged menstrual periods
– Pelvic pressure or pain
– Frequent urination
– Difficulty emptying the bladder
– Constipation
– Backache or leg pains
The exact cause of fibroids is unknown, but factors like hormonal imbalances, genetics, and lifestyle may contribute to their development.
Traditional Treatments for Fibroids
Conventional treatments for fibroids include:
– **Medications**: To regulate hormones and alleviate symptoms.
– **Non-invasive procedures**: Such as MRI-guided focused ultrasound surgery.
– **Minimally invasive procedures**: Including uterine artery embolization and laparoscopic myomectomy.
– **Traditional surgical procedures**: Like abdominal myomectomy or hysterectomy.
The choice of treatment depends on the size and location of the fibroids, symptoms, and the patient’s desire for future pregnancies.
What is Faforon?
Faforon is a herbal supplement marketed as a “liquid stem cell” product. It’s produced by FAFORLIFE and claims to address various health issues, including fibroids, infertility, and general wellness. The supplement is composed of several natural ingredients known for their medicinal properties.
Key Ingredients in Faforon
– **Khaya grandifoliola**: Traditionally used in West African medicine for treating fever, malaria, and gastrointestinal issues.
– **Boscia angustifolia**: Known for its antimicrobial properties and used to treat diarrhea and respiratory infections.
– **Sorghum bicolor**: A grain rich in antioxidants, vitamins, and minerals, supporting overall health.
– **Cocoa species**: Contains flavanols that may reduce inflammation and improve heart health.
– **Dialium guineense**: Used in traditional medicine to treat fever, diarrhea, and infections.
These ingredients are believed to work synergistically to enhance the body’s natural healing processes.
Claims About Faforon and Fibroids
Proponents of Faforon suggest that it can:
– Regulate menstrual flow and alleviate pain.
– Improve fertility in women.
– Eliminate hardened mucus in the body, which may result in cysts, tumors (fibroids), or polyps.
However, it’s essential to note that these claims are based on anecdotal evidence and have not been substantiated by rigorous scientific studies.
Scientific Perspective on Faforon and Fibroids
Currently, there is limited scientific research evaluating the effectiveness of Faforon in treating fibroids. While some of its ingredients have shown potential health benefits, there’s no conclusive evidence that Faforon can shrink or eliminate fibroids.
For instance, certain plant-derived compounds, like resveratrol, have demonstrated inhibitory effects on fibroid cells in laboratory settings. However, these findings have not translated into approved treatments, and the efficacy of such compounds in humans remains uncertain.
